Keeping up on Pediatric Immunizations

For many parents, navigating back-to-school is very different this year. Whether your family is distance learning from home, in-person at school, or somewhere in between, it is important to keep children up-to-date on immunizations. By not delaying immunizations, children can be better protected against preventable diseases like measles and chickenpox, especially if they have a weakened immune system.

Summer Skin Safety

Summer is all about heading outdoors for fun activities, fresh air, and to soak in some Vitamin D from the sun. It’s important to remember that without protection, exposure to the sun’s ultraviolet (UV) rays can damage your skin in as little as 15 minutes. Over time, this can lead to skin cancer, which is the most common cancer in the U.S. Fortunately, most skin cancers can be prevented. Sutter Walk-In Care is Now Open in Folsom

Sutter Health Plus members now have access to a new Sutter Walk-In Care in Folsom, providing same-day care for everyday illnesses and health needs—at the same cost share as a primary care visit. The new location is at 2766 East Bidwell St., Suite 600 in the Broadstone Marketplace.

Spotlight on Men’s Health

In general, men and women have different attitudes about health. Men tend to put off regular checkups and medical care more so than women. When they finally do see a doctor, men are more likely to have a serious health condition. That is one reason why in the United States, on average, men can expect to live five fewer years than women.

Convenient Pharmacy Options

Right now, filling a prescription at the pharmacy may not require leaving the car—or even your home. To help people save time and trips into the pharmacy, many Sutter Health Plus network pharmacies, including CVS Pharmacy, Rite Aid and Walgreens, currently offer drive-thru pickup or free one to two-day delivery options for eligible prescription drugs.
